Transaction 891ea521e766a7b14391b2307a680574b43df68cbe4a78faee66372bf272a12f

1 Input
2 Outputs
  • 891ea521e766a7b14391b2307a680574b43df68cbe4a78faee66372bf272a12f:0
  • value  2110500
    address  1MBCKDJaVNGid4PQqEXMzZX3XZ1PE2SNcK
  • 891ea521e766a7b14391b2307a680574b43df68cbe4a78faee66372bf272a12f:1
  • value  26492483
    address  bc1q3g5rph8vkayjupzqhyur3dady4wxp5zxrqsxzg